Tsunami Affected Areas Rebuilding Project (TAARP)– ADB Loan No. 2167 – Road Rebuilding and Rehabilitation – Phase 1 Outline Design and Preparation of Bidding Documents - National Roads in South and South East Region

The Government recognizes that thorough and permanent road rebuilding measures are necessary to protect the roadway network of main transport links and feeder roads along the coastal belt affected by the tsunami. This project targets rehabilitating approximately 300 kms. of national coastal A and B class roads and 200 kms. of associated provincial roads in the Southern and South East regions. The primary objective of the assignment is to provide a reliable, sustainable, maintainable and safer road system in the tsunami affected areas. Rehabilitation of national roads will be undertaken on the existing horizontal alignment and within the existing right of way where possible
